When a man traveled 1200 km from Scooty to test his pregnant wife, his discussion started across the country. Dhananjay, a resident of Godda district of Jharkhand, traveled about 1200 km to Gwalior in Madhya Pradesh to get his wife tested. Dhananjay's wife's name is Soni. On September 11, he completed his D.Ed. (Diploma in Education) Examination.
It was not easy for Dhananjay to get away from Scooty, as his wife is pregnant. But he also did not want his wife to miss the exam due to the Corona crisis. In such a situation, he planned to reach the examination center from Scooty.
Running Scooty with his pregnant wife was painful for him. After the exam, his biggest tension was that he would have to return home 1200 km from Scooty. But both the couples who came to Madhya Pradesh have now been given a flight ticket to return home.

According to the news agency ANI, after the story of the couple from Jharkhand came to the media, a corporate veteran gave them a ship ticket for the return trip. Both couples have expressed gratitude for this. Explain that this will be the first time that these two people will travel by airplane.
Dhananjay told, We have got a flight ticket from Gwalior to Ranchi. This ticket is on 16 September. There is no direct flight from Gwalior to Ranchi, so both of us will reach Ranchi via Hyderabad. After this, Godda will be done by road from Ranchi. This has been arranged by the District Magistrate of Godda.
He further said, arrangements have also been made to send my scooty. Also, his stay was arranged by the Gwalior administration near the examination center. He said that some people have also talked about arranging jobs in Godda.
His wife Soni told the news agency ANI, "I want to become a teacher. For this I have given D.Ed. (Diploma in Education) examination. In such a situation, the students appearing for the examination are facing a lot of difficulty in reaching the examination center on time.
